> > On 06/04/2012 04:55 PM, Nicholas Tustison wrote:
> >> Hi Arnaud,
> >>
> >> Yes, so that means that one of your data points is outside the
> >> user-defined parametric domain.  Even if it is right on the edge,
> >> the parametric domain is open-ended on the right side which
> >> will cause this exception to be thrown.  How are you setting up
> >> your parametric domain?  In other words, what does your call
> >> look like when you're setting up the filter?
> >>
> >> Nick
